Two adult patients with the diagnosis of gastric lymphoma who developed adenocarcinoma of the stomach 8 years after the treatment are presented. Both patients were treated by subtotal gastrectomy followed by irradiation of 4,000–4,500 cGy to the epigastric region and six courses of chemotherapy (vincristine, cyclophosphamide, prednisolone). In our review of the literature, 16 cases of gastric adenocarcinoma following the treatment of gastric lymphoma were found and listed with details. The factors influencing the development of this secondary carcinoma, mainly those treatment related are discussed. The possible role of both radiotherapy and chemotherapy in shortening the latent period for the development of stump carcinoma is emphasized. © 1993 Wiley-Liss, Inc.  相似文献

Spindle cell lesions of the breast are rare entities and pose a diagnostic challenge for pathologists due to overlapping morphologic and immunohistochemical features. We evaluated EZH2 expression in various benign (fibromatosis (n = 8), myofibroblastoma (n = 7), neurofibroma (n = 1), nodular fasciitis (n = 5), benign phyllodes tumor (n = 18)) and malignant (malignant phyllodes tumor (n = 8), metaplastic breast carcinoma (n = 16) and angiosarcoma (n = 8)) spindle cell lesions as a potential diagnostic and therapeutic marker. The EZH2 expression was evaluated semi-quantitatively to categorize the cases as ‘low’ and ‘high’ expression. All benign lesions showed low EZH2 expression, whereas high EZH2 expression was observed in the majority (28/32; 88%) of malignant lesions. The study results suggest that EZH2 may be used both as an additional diagnostic tool to reach an accurate diagnosis of the spindle cell lesions of the breast and as a therapeutic target for the malignant lesions.  相似文献

Gastrointestinal system anastomoses, especially colonic anastomoses, have significant morbidity and mortality despite recent technical improvements. Besides regulating the circadian rhythm, the pineal gland and its main neurohormone product melatonin have widespread actions in the organism. The purpose of this study was to investigate the effects of pinealectomy on the healing of colonic anastomoses. One hundred male albino Wistar rats were used in this study. The rats were separated into three groups: control, pinealectomy, and sham groups. In the control group, only colonic resection and anastomoses were performed. Following pinealectomy, colonic anastomosis was performed 2 weeks later on one half and 2 months later on the other half of the pinealectomy group. Only craniotomy was performed on the sham group, and the rats were separated and evaluated like the pinealectomy group. Colonic anastomoses were evaluated on postanastomotic day 3 and 7 by measuring the bursting pressure and the hydroxyproline levels in the anastomotic segments. There was no difference in the bursting pressure measurements between the groups on both postoperative day 3 and 7. Although hydroxyproline levels were different between groups on both postanastomotic days 3 and 7, it has been observed that neither normal nor anastomotic hydroxyproline levels influenced the anastomotic bursting pressure measurements. The percent deviation from the normal values was compared in the anastomotic segments, and no differences were found regarding the bursting pressure and hydroxyproline levels. It was concluded that pinealectomy has no effect on the healing of colonic anastomoses.  相似文献

Neovascularization, the development of a new microvasculature, has an important role in physiological and pathological processes. The vascular changes in the brain can be easily detected because the proliferation of endothelial cells in its vascular structure is quite small, and so constitutes a good model for neovascularization studies. In the present investigation, to induce intracerebral neovascularization, we implanted collagen, Interleukin-l alpha (IL-lα) and glicosaminoglycan into the brain ofpigs, in order to test the hypothesis that IL-l α, collagen and glicosaminoglycan play a pivotal. role in the process of neovascularization. Both pure collagen and collagen combined with IL-l a induced neovascularization according to light-electron microscopic findings and values of enzymes' activities. In particular, collagen combined with IL-lα synergically affected the increase of neovascularization. However, glicosarrinoglycan did not affect it significantly. Although the results of this study provided us with some interesting data indicating the beneficial effects of collagen combined with IL-1α on neovascularization, further studies should be done to study the short term effect of these biochemical substances. BACKGROUND: Different ovulation trigger methods such as gonadotropin releasing hormone-agonist (GnRH-a) and recombinant human chorionic gonadotropin (r-hCG) plus rescue oocyte retrieval might reveal oocytes in patients with recurrent empty follicle syndrome. CASE: Endogenous luteinizing hormone was triggered with a GnRH-a (Buserelin [Suprefact pro-injection, Aventis-Pharma, Turkey], 250 microg subcutaneously) in a GnRH antagonist (Cetrorelix [Cetrotide 0.25, SeronoTurkey], 0.25 mg/d, starting on day 6), down-regulated cycle. At the first scheduled retrieval, 3 cumulus-oocytecorona complexes were recovered from the left ovary. During chemical denudation with hyaluronidase, 2 of them underwent lysis. The third was a zona-free, germinalvesicle-stage oocyte after mechanical denudation. Oocyte pickup was stopped, and recombinant human chorionic gonadotropin (hCG) (250 microg subcutaneously) was injected. Five cumulus-oocyte-corona complexes were retrieved from the right ovary 24 hours after rescue with recombinant hCG. Only mechanical denudation was done, and 4 zona-free oocytes with germinal vesicle breakdown were seen. All oocytes underwent intracytoplasmic sperm injection, and none of them were fertilized. CONCLUSION: Oocyte maturation defects should be included in etiologic mechanisms for counseling patients with empty follicle syndrome.  相似文献

BACKGROUND: Angiogenesis has an important role in liver regeneration. Antiangiogenic response in remnant liver following resection and its relationship to regeneration is not well known. The aim of this study was to investigate the effect of hepatectomy size on serum endostatin levels, and the effect of endostatin levels to liver regeneration after partial hepatectomy in normal and cirrhotic mice. MATERIALS AND METHODS: Sixty noncirrhotic and 36 carbon tetrachloride-induced cirrhotic mice were included in the study. Noncirrhotic mice were randomly divided into four main groups: sham, 20%, 40%, and 70% hepatectomy groups. Similarly, cirrhotic mice were randomly divided into three main groups: sham, 20%, and 40% hepatectomy groups. The mice in each group were further divided into two subgroups to compare serum endostatin levels and liver regeneration indexes on days 1 and 14. Liver regeneration was evaluated by the proliferating cell nuclear antigen-labeling index. Serum endostatin level was measured to evaluate antiangiogenic response. RESULTS: Serum endostatin levels on the first day and 14th day increased significantly in correlation with the hepatectomy size, both in normal mice and cirrhotic mice (P < 0.05). In normal mice with high regeneration indexes that underwent 40% and 70% hepatectomies, there was a significant increase in serum endostatin levels on the 14th day compared with the first day (P < 0.05). However, the increase in mice that underwent 20% hepatectomies was not significant. After 20% and 40% hepatectomies, first day serum endostatin levels were significantly higher in cirrhotic mice compared with normal mice (P < 0.05), which was independent of regeneration. Nevertheless, after 40% hepatectomies, 14th day serum endostatin levels were significantly lower in cirrhotic mice compared with normal mice, attributable to the limited regeneration capacity of cirrhotic liver (P < 0.05). Regeneration capacity of cirrhotic liver was low at all times. CONCLUSIONS: The current study suggests that there is a significant relationship between serum endostatin levels and regeneration capacity after hepatectomy in normal mice. On the other hand, following resection of cirrhotic liver, regeneration capacity is depressed and high endostatin levels are independent of hepatic regeneration.  相似文献

BACKGROUND AND OBJECTIVE: The aim of our study was to investigate, in rabbits with hydrochloric (HCl) acid-induced Acute Lung Injury (ALI), the effects of intra-tracheal (i.t.) dexamethasone administration on neutrophil and platelet counts, plasma malonyl dialdehyde (MDA) level, histopathology, and arterial blood gases. METHODS: Twenty-eight New Zealand rabbits were randomly divided into a control (n = 14) and dexamethasone groups (n = 14). Anesthesia was applied with ketamine (50 mg kg(-1) h(-1), i.m.) and tracheostomy was performed. Both groups received 2 ml kg(-1) HCl (hydrochloric acid) i.t.. Five minutes later, 0.9% saline was given to the controls while the other group received i.t. dexamethasone. MDA levels of the plasma, neutrophil and platelet counts, and arterial blood gases were recorded at the beginning of the study and then at two and five hours. The rabbits were ventilated in pressure control mode for 5 hours. At the end of the study, the lungs were examined by light microscopy and the changes evaluated on a scale of 0 to 4. RESULTS: Neutrophil and platelets counts (p < 0.01) and PaO2 (p < 0.05) were greater in the dexamethasone group than the controls at five hours. Plasma MDA level (p < 0.01) and PaCO2 (p < 0.01) were greater in the control group. Histopathological changes were less severe in the dexamethasone group. CONCLUSION: Giving dexamethasone i.t. may have beneficial effects on the development of ALI.  相似文献

Cystic Hydatid Disease: Current Trends in Diagnosis and Management   总被引:4,自引:0,他引:4  
Sayek I  Tirnaksiz MB  Dogan R 《Surgery today》2004,34(12):987-996
Cystic echinococcosis is endemic in certain parts of the world. The growth of the cyst is often slow, and the liver and lungs are the most frequently involved organs. Diagnosis is based on clinical signs and symptoms and epidemiological data, while ultrasonography is important for the classification of hydatid cysts. Although certain types of hydatid cysts are successfully treated by percutaneous aspiration, injection, and reaspiration, surgery remains the treatment of choice. We reviewed the current trends in the diagnosis and management of cystic echinococcosis, with special emphasis on hepatic and pulmonary involvement.  相似文献

Using methylation-specific real-time PCR, we determined the prevalence of aberrant methylation in the mismatch repair gene hMLH1 and in the recently described HPP1 gene among 50 esophageal, 50 cardiac and 50 gastric ADCs. Additionally, expression of hMLH1 protein was detected immunohistochemically and correlated with DNA MSI. Hypermethylation of hMLH1 was found in 14% of esophageal, 28% of cardiac and 32% of gastric ADCs, whereas HPP1 hypermethylation was found more frequently in the 3 tumor types (64% vs. 38% vs. 54%). In gastric ADC, HPP1 hypermethylation was found more frequently in tumors with concomitant hMLH1 hypermethylation (81%) than in those without hMLH1 hypermethylation (41%, p = 0.008). Complete loss of hMLH1 protein expression, which was present in 10 carcinomas (5 cardiac and 5 gastric), was invariably correlated with hMLH1 hypermethylation and MSI. In conclusion, our data indicate that MSI and loss of the mismatch repair protein hMLH1, which is mainly caused by hMLH1 gene hypermethylation, are more prevalent in stomach and cardia carcinogenesis than in that of the esophagus. Moreover, in gastric cancer, hMLH1 hypermethylation is correlated with hypermethylation of the HPP1 gene.  相似文献
